You need at least Firefox 128 or 115.13.0 ESR to be able to use extensions.

more options

The latest slimbrowser (118..0.0.0) only uses FF 115.0 as an engine. All my FF add-ons stopped working today, so I assume this is the issue.

Does this mean slimbrowser users cannot use FF add-ons until they make a release based on FF >115.13?

Thanks for the link. I already did that. Doesn't work.

xpinstall.signatures.required to false extensions.langpacks.signatures.required to false. restart.

Looks like slimbrowser users are stuffed until the next update.
